Responsibilities
- The Truck Driver drives a truck to transport materials, merchandise, equipment, or workers between various types of establishments such as: manufacturing plants, freight depots, warehouses, wholesale and retail establishments, or between retail establishments and customers’ houses or places of business.
- This driver may also load or unload truck with or without helpers, make minor mechanical repairs, and keep truck in good working order.
- There are two Truck Driver categories on the EAGLE contract. They include:
- TRUCKDRIVER, HEAVY TRUCK: Straight truck, over 4 tons, usually 10 wheels.
- TRUCKDRIVER, TRACTOR-TRAILER: A trailer having a set or several sets of wheels at the rear only, with the forward portion being supported by the truck tractor or towing.
Qualifications
- Heavy Truck Driver candidate must have a Commercial Driver’s License.
- Must have a minimum of 4+ years truck driving experience.
- Must have the ability to pass Pre-Employment Drug Test and Background Screening.
- Must have a current and valid medical card.
- Must have a minimum of a High School Diploma/GED.
- Must have the ability to receive a favorable TIER-1 investigation result.
